Sat 764330096530120

decimal
152866.96530120
degree
0°152866′1666″96530120‴
percentile
36.396671303375406%
name
ikzaluqccaz
cycle
0
epoch
0
period
75
block
152866
offset
96530120
timestamp
rarity
common